How many management providers can a Limited Licensee work for at the same time?

A Limited Licensee can only work for one management provider at a time. This regulation is in place to ensure that the Limited Licensee can focus on their duties and responsibilities within a single organization, allowing for better accountability and compliance with the standards and regulations set by the Condominium Management Regulatory Authority of Ontario.

Working with multiple management providers could lead to conflicts of interest and hinder effective communication and decision-making processes. By limiting the number of management providers to one, the framework fosters a more organized and professional approach to condominium management, thereby enhancing service quality and maintaining ethical standards in the industry. This clear structure is designed to protect the interests of both the licensees and the clients they serve.
